Description
The Sliding Pendant 500mm YG1850 is a revolutionary medical bridge system designed for both adult and neonatal intensive care units, offering complete patient monitoring solutions with its innovative dry-wet separation technology. This 500mm sliding pendant features dual-section configuration that intelligently separates infusion equipment (wet section) from monitoring devices (dry section) for enhanced safety and organization.
Key specifications include:
- Comprehensive gas delivery: 4 O₂ (2 wet/2 dry), 2 air, 2 vacuum outlets
- Advanced power distribution: 12 total power sockets (6 wet/6 dry) + 2 network ports
- Smart cable management: All pipelines and wires fully concealed within tower
- Height-adjustable platform: For ergonomic positioning during procedures
- 340° rotation capability: With secure braking system to prevent drift

Technical Specification
Model | YG1850 |
Wet Section Configuration | |
Gas Socket (German Standard) – O2 | 2 |
Gas Socket (German Standard) – Air | 1 |
Gas Socket (German Standard) – Vacuum | 1 |
Shelf | 2 |
Drawer | 1 |
IV Pole | 1 |
Multi-purpose Power Socket | 6 |
Communication Socket RJ45 | 1 |
Grounding Terminal | 1 |
Dry Section Configuration | |
Gas Socket (German Standard) – O2 | 2 |
Gas Socket (German Standard) – Air | 1 |
Gas Socket (German Standard) – Vacuum | 1 |
Shelf | 3 |
Drawer | 1 |
IV Pole | 1 |
Multi-purpose Power Socket | 6 |
Communication Socket RJ45 | 1 |
Grounding Terminal | 1 |
